    The present invention relates to an unmanned guided vehicle charging apparatus. According to one embodiment of the present invention, in the unmanned guided vehicle charging apparatus, a position of a charging connector of the unmanned guided vehicle charging apparatus is not fixed and is implemented to be adjustable by a certain distance in up, down, left and right directions. Accordingly, when an unmanned guided vehicle approaches a charging station for charging, the position of the charging connector is automatically adjusted up, down, left and right according to a position of a power receiving connector of the unmanned guided vehicle. As a result, a problem in which charging is not performed properly due to a contact mismatch between the charging connector and the power receiving connector to which a charging power is supplied is prevented, and stable charging is possible. The unmanned guided vehicle charging apparatus of the present invention comprises: a distance measuring sensor; a beam sensor; a connector transferring unit; a connector aligning unit; a connector connecting unit; and a control unit.
